* ''No in-class overloading'', which by assigning the same name to different features within a single context, causes confusions, errors, and conflicts with object-oriented mechanisms such as dynamic binding. (Dynamic binding itself is a powerful form of inter-class overloading, without any of these dangers.)
|
||||
* ''No goto instructions'' or similar control structures (break, exit, multiple-exit loops) which break the simplicity of the control flow and make it harder or impossible to reason about the software (in particular through loop invariants and variants).
|
||||
* ''No exceptions to the type rules''. To be credible, a type system must not allow unchecked "casts" converting from a type to another. (Safe cast-like operations are available through object test.)
